Since 2005, the Urban Soul Café serves as a vehicle to promote the urban Gospel music genre and provide a safe haven for Christians to fellowship with one another in a less structured setting without losing the focus of Christ.  Throughout the years, the café’s territory increases fruitfully as record attendance numbers continue to shoot through the roof. Over 200 major and independent artists have appeared on the Urban Soul Café stage.  “It’s more than music, it’s a lifestyle,” says Mr. Hale. “There’s fun, excitement, networking and there is Jesus in the midst.”
